We have ranked, compared and reviewed some of the best share-dealing platforms and accounts in the UK that are regulated by the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A). The main things to compare when choosing a share dealing account are the costs of buying and selling shares (trading fees) and how much it will cost to keep those shares on your account. You should also compare account types so you have the option to deal shares in a tax-efficient ISA, SIPP or for your children.
